Pharmacogenomics Market Expected to Reach $5.8 Billion by 2028 as Personalized Medicine Gains Momentum

The global Pharmacogenomics Market is experiencing robust growth as healthcare systems increasingly embrace personalized medicine and genomics-driven drug development. According to MarketsandMarkets™, the market is projected to grow from USD 3.5 billion in 2023 to USD 5.8 billion by 2028, registering a CAGR of 10.6% during the forecast period.

Pharmacogenomics combines pharmacology and genomics to understand how genetic variations influence an individual’s response to medications. By enabling healthcare providers to tailor treatments based on a patient’s genetic profile, pharmacogenomics is transforming disease management, improving therapeutic outcomes, and reducing adverse drug reactions.

Growing Burden of Chronic Diseases Fuels Market Expansion

One of the primary factors driving the pharmacogenomics market is the increasing prevalence of chronic and genetic diseases worldwide.

Conditions such as:

  • Cancer
  • Cardiovascular diseases
  • Neurological disorders
  • Rare genetic disorders

require highly personalized treatment approaches. Pharmacogenomic testing helps identify the most effective therapies while minimizing side effects, leading to improved patient outcomes and healthcare efficiency.

Additionally, rising investments in genomic research and increasing government funding for precision medicine initiatives continue to accelerate market growth.

Kits & Reagents Lead the Product Segment

Based on product and service, the pharmacogenomics market is segmented into:

  • Kits & Reagents
  • Services

The kits & reagents segment accounted for the largest market share in 2022.

This dominance can be attributed to:

  • Growing adoption of pharmacogenomic testing
  • Expanding genomic research activities
  • Continuous technological advancements
  • Increasing demand for rapid and reliable testing solutions

Kits and reagents serve as essential components in genomic analysis workflows, supporting laboratories, hospitals, and research institutions worldwide.

Sequencing Technologies Driving Innovation

Based on technology, the market is categorized into:

  • Sequencing
  • PCR
  • Microarray
  • Other Technologies

The sequencing segment held the largest market share in 2022 and is expected to register the highest growth rate during the forecast period.

Advanced sequencing technologies enable researchers and clinicians to:

  • Identify genetic variants affecting drug metabolism
  • Analyze complex genomic data with greater accuracy
  • Support biomarker discovery
  • Facilitate personalized treatment planning

The continuous development of next-generation sequencing (NGS) platforms and associated reagents is significantly expanding the scope of pharmacogenomics applications.

Cancer Remains the Largest Disease Area

Among disease areas, the cancer segment accounted for the largest share of the pharmacogenomics market in 2022.

Several factors contribute to this leadership:

  • Rising global cancer incidence
  • Increased funding for oncology research
  • Growing adoption of targeted therapies
  • Expansion of companion diagnostics

Pharmacogenomics plays a critical role in oncology by helping identify patients most likely to benefit from specific treatments while minimizing treatment-related toxicity.

As precision oncology continues to advance, pharmacogenomic testing is expected to become a standard component of cancer care pathways.
